SABIC NORYL GTX™ Resin GTX8408 Polyphenylene Ether + PA (PPE+Nylon)
Categories: Polymer; Thermoplastic; Nylon (Polyamide PA); Polyphenylene Ether/PPO

Material Notes: NORYL GTX™ GTX8408 resin is an 8% glass reinforced alloy of Polyphenylene Ether (PPE) + Polyamide (PA). This injection moldable grade exhibits high elongation, excellent chemical resistance, high heat resistance, and flow. NORYL GTX8408 resin is an excellent candidate for a wide variety of structural and electrical connector applications.
